ENGINE DETAIL

The John Deere 855 tractor features a Yanmar 3TN75RJ engine known for its robust 24 hp output and efficient direct injection fuel system, ideal for small to medium farming tasks. Its liquid-cooled, 3-cylinder design ensures operational stability and longevity, with a high compression ratio of 17.8:1 benefiting fuel efficiency. However, with an oil capacity of only 3.8 quarts, maintenance intervals should be monitored closely to prevent potential engine wear, particularly during prolonged operation within the 1400-3425 RPM range.

Description Yanmar 3TN75RJ/diesel/3-cylinder/liquid-cooled
Displacement 60.7 ci/1.0 L
Bore/Stroke 2.95x2.95 inches/75 x 75 mm
Power 24 hp/17.9 kW
Fuel system direct injection
Air cleaner dry element
Pre-heating air heater
Compression 17.8:1
Rated RPM 3200
Operating RPM 1400-3425
Starter volts 12
Oil capacity 3.8 qts/3.6 L
Coolant capacity 4 qts/3.8 L

TRANSMISSION

The John Deere 855 features a Sunstrand Series 17 hydrostatic transmission, allowing infinite control of speed and direction with two foot pedals, enhancing maneuverability in tight spaces. The 18 qt oil capacity ensures adequate lubrication and cooling of the system, potentially reducing maintenance frequency. However, hydrostatic systems may exhibit performance degradation in extreme heat or heavy loads, so consider operational limits when working under such conditions.

Transmission Sunstrand Series 17
Type hydrostatic
Gears infinite (2-range) forward and reverse
Oil capacity 18 qts/17.0 L
Description Hydrostatic transmission controlled by two right-side foot pedals. Cruise control is standard.

HYDRAULICS

Type open center
Capacity 4.5 gal/17.0 L
Pressure 2050 psi/141.3 bar
Rear valves 2
Mid valves 2
Total flow 5.6 gpm/21.2 lpm

TRACTOR HITCH

Rear Type I
Control position control
Rear lift (at 24 785 lbs/356 kg

POWER TAKE-OFF (PTO)

Rear PTO independent
Rear RPM 540
Engine RPM 2100@3200
Mid PTO independent
Mid RPM 2100

855 SERIAL NUMBERS

Location Serial number plate on rear of the John Deere 855, below the PTO shaft.
1986 M00855D360001 (4WD SCV)
1987 M00855D420001 (4WD SCV)
1988 M00855D475001 (4WD SCV)
1989 M00855D010001 (4WD SCV)
1990 M00855D010001 (4WD SCV)
1991 M00855D125001 (4WD SCV)
1992 LV0855D125700 (4WD SCV)
1993 LV0855D160000 (4WD SCV)
1994 LV0855D180001 (4WD SCV)
1995 LV0855D181952 (4WD SCV)
1996 LV0855E190001
1997 LV0855E200001
1998 LV0855E300001
